Join us for an adventure that's part dinner party and all improvised role-play! Each episode five friends combine forces to weave a tale of fantasy, food, and fun in a home-brewed D&D campaign. There's powerful spells, magic horses, other realms, and enough excitement and laughs for everyone to get seconds.

A strange time to revisit as we go back to spring of 2020 for our first remote recording and a lore heavy side quest to Yanathan's secret flying fortress in the Fey Wild. Enjoy this double session from season 3! more
Cue the jangly guitar and stare down that tunnel, it's our James Bond mountain side chase from season 5! Flaghetti is out in full force as the Team escapes Cedric's lair. more
Time to go back to Middleton for this cheesy caper packed with plenty of laughs, lore, and your friends Thran and Kran. more
We're going back to season 3 for best of number 3! Before we return to present day where the Team is in trouble on a boat, let's reminisce about perhaps their grandest maritime adventure - the trip to Oyakodo aboard the Dorlea. Remember Rat Trap? How... more
